Where's the beef? 7/12/2006

I'm tired of going to Chinese restaurants and getting bad cuts of meat. This place is the final straw for me. I ordered the sesame beef - which is breaded beef in a sauce - and there was hardly any beef in the dish. It was mainly fried breading - occasionally with a string of grissle in the middle- swimming in a too-sweet sauce. Like a chinese version of a funnel cake. We were not impressed - though sadly we've had this problem at other Chinese restaurants. I'm done - I'm going out for Thai or Vietnamese from now on. Pros: Clean bathrooms Cons: Skimpy on the meat, heavy sauces more

use to have good service 12/11/2003

I use to love to eat at China Sea when no one knew about it and the service was great. But now everyone goes there and it takes forever to get your food. I usually get my order to go because it was a fast alternative to fast food. Well they always tell you it will be ready in 10 min no matter what you order or how many orders they have. For the last couple of months I have to wait 30 min. Also with more people eatting at China Sea the quality of the food has gone down. You could get good quality food one day and get horrible food the next. It also seems like there are always new employees that don't know anything. One good things is that there is a very nice young man that works in the front who is always very helpful. Pros: cheap, usually fast, good food Cons: wait time, bad food more
